The thirteenth Machine Translation Summit, organized by the International Association for Machine Translation (IAMT) and hosted by the Asia-Pacific Association for Machine Translation (AAMT), will be held in Xiamen, China, from 19 to 23 September 2011.

Deadline for the submission of papers : June 20th, 2011

MT Summit XIII will feature a comprehensive program that will include research papers, reports on
users' experiences, discussions of policy issues, invited talks, panels, exhibits, tutorials, and
workshops. We define machine translation in the broadest possible sense, to include not just fully
automatic MT but tools for translation support and multilingual text processing as well.
We invite all those with an interest in translation automation-researchers, developers, translation
service providers, users, or managers-to participate in the conference.

MT Summit XIII hereby invites original submissions on all aspects machine and machine-aided
translation. The submissions must be in English and fall into one of three categories:

* research (or theoretical) papers
* user's studies (including manager's experiences)
* system presentations (with optional demos)
